Type
ORACLE
Validation date
2025-01-23 01:56: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01463,
    "usd": 0.01523
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000166429AEC002D11E7B5B45DB4E6F33D330AFD11D8F536E773648D971308F82327

Previous signature

900481FD542B62007E8F7CED9FFCDDE6BBDA571D8DA53310679086AB3682D0927F44FEFBAD0E63BC0632E5632BF3782424F8BAB42CAC85E5E60AE6CFAD35F00C

Origin signature

3045022100E6321B2EF6D691231E1E663F505D5B35ECB7C2CD8991A46C7356DBDCD1CCD873022011D3AA86796EC3A9079AE2AD21B451CE181EB8DDFC75F9F84F667E6BB48D94A2

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00E5D3AA7E8295D295BC4A0210CEF7F2473CD3BD5BC998FEE98624B95B022B4FDC

Coordinator signature

6C45D77D37A30165C98FC57C974F583E53399B0DEF9B710396DAEFCA8AF55A1CD0835AB7E2E3CA362D1A770B5FAF01CFC47BB9B4C93D463E0B8F46B0055A3B08

Validator #1 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#1 signature

0D2700901C7103FA31AF0702302CD5F79D42172E6371F38B70179993B8D84EFCB524D7EB47AD60D98C8FD98289035A2B8776F6040E3C05869909997CE920F90D

Validator #2 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#2 signature

AF25B853893C861F993C49715E2417D5CEA0EC5E3181453BE63969AA8E55BF7FDC7ED4C65B1433AC51E320CC068F89E47ED58B23BCCAFB462B43CAB56904300B